Transaction 27518dcaa94dcf5560149edb63e6f63b26b5af05fa357d975658ba40482c3313
1 Input
1 Output
-
27518dcaa94dcf5560149edb63e6f63b26b5af05fa357d975658ba40482c3313:0
- value
- 4763373
- script pubkey
- OP_0 OP_PUSHBYTES_20 a82a9498252ca50e2b5a5a25938f619d920b2be3
- address
- bc1q4q4ffxp99jjsu266tgje8rmpnkfqk2lr44jr9e